HP Compaq Elite 8300 Small Form Factor PC (ENERGY STAR)
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

Wi-Fi is available in home but pc will not ackowledge.  I have to used a wired connection.  What is missing?

 

5 REPLIES 5
HP Recommended

Hi:

 

Since probably 95% of 8300 Elite desktop PC's did not come with built in Wi-Fi, that would be the reason why you can't connect to any wireless networks.

 

The easiest thing to do to add Wi-Fi to your PC would be to purchase a USB Wi-Fi adapter.
